Get inbound links from relevant pages and use relevant tagged images can increase your page relevance. While, the relevance of your site’s content to the lives of your visitors is another aspect. We’ll mainly talk about this kind of relevance here.
Most of us hope to boost our sites’ rankings only by researching the search engines algorithms. That’s why we cannot see that much effect in this campaign. Try to factor in every possible aspect to build up your SEO strategy. Actually, the daily happening in search engine users’ lives is one of them. It sounds crazy to have the possibility to know everything that goes on with one person’s life not to speak of your target audience.
For example, with all the troubled economy nowadays, you can be pretty sure that lots of people are trying to find ways to cut on spending. Keywords like “cheap SEO”, “affordable SEO” may become the more popular words people use. Another simple example would be industry events. Mentioning big events will show that you are aware of what’s going on. Besides, visitors who might have overlooked it or forgot about it will be happy to be informed. It’s not enough to get relevant. You should stay relevant. You may get high rankings for targeted keywords. But if people start to search for other keywords you will end up with no one visiting your site.
